Abstract

本发明公开了一种电池包,包括壳体,内置于该壳体中的电芯或电芯组件,以及电路板,其还包括:第一电连接器,其将电芯或电芯组件正负极的一端与电路板相连接;第二电连接器,其将电芯或电芯组件正负极的另一端与电路板相连接;第三电连接器,其配置于电路板,适于电连接到外部的用电设备,使得来自电芯的电力可以通过第三电连接器提供给用电设备;第三电连接器具有孔式端子,其与外部的用电设备的针式端子压力配合。该技术方案使得来自电芯的电力可以通过第三电连接器提供给用电设备,孔式端子的配置使用能够便于电池包端口处的密封设计,包括防尘密封,防水密封等。

具体实施方式
下面结合附图和实施例,对本发明的具体实施方式作进一步详细描述。以下实施例用于说明本发明,但不能用来限制本发明的范围。
实施例1:
本发明实施例的一种电池包,如图1、图2、图3、图4、图5所 示,包括壳体1,内置于壳体1中的电芯2和电路板3,还包括:
第一电连接器4,其将电芯2正负极的一端与电路板3相连接;
第二电连接器5,其将电芯2正负极的另一端与电路板3相连接;
如图1所示,本实施例中,第三电连接器6,其配置于电路板3,第三电连接器6包括本体和与该本体注塑一体的针孔式端子10,针孔式端子10用于与外部的用电设备电连接,使得来自电芯2的电力可以通过第三电连接器提供给用电设备;第四电连接器7,其配置于电路板3,并包括至少一第二接口12,第二接口12用于与外部的用电设备和充电源电连接,使得既可以通过第二接口12提供电力给用电设备;又可以通过第二接口12向电芯2提供电荷,根据实际产品需求,可以将第三电连接器6和第四电连接器7设置在电池包的同一侧,根据产品实际需求,也可以设置在电池包相对的两侧;
本实施例中的第二接口12既可用于放电也可用于充电,具体来说,第二接口12为type-C接口,如图5所示,针孔式端子10用于为各种手持电动工具供电,例如无绳吸尘器、直流空压机以及其他园林工具等,并且采用针孔式接线端子能够有效提高电池包的防水密封效果,并且插接起来更加方便;本实施例的电池包结构小巧,还能作为移动电源使用,此时,可通过采用type-C接口的第二接口12为手机、平板等移动设备充电,同时还能通过type-C接口为电池包的电芯2进行充电。
具体来说,本实施例中的电池包还包括支撑骨架8,支撑骨架8用于安装电芯2和电路板3,如图2所示,电芯2采用单节21700电芯,支撑骨架8上部为弧形凹槽用于设置电芯2,并且支撑骨架8与电芯2之间设有绝缘垫15;能够起到漏电保护的作用,特别是当电芯2表皮破损的情况发生时,保证不会出现漏电的情况。
在本实施例中,为了实现电路板3间隔支撑于支撑骨架8上,通 过在支撑骨架8底部两侧分别设有2个伸出的支撑卡块16;在支撑骨架8底部两侧分别设有2个卡接扣板17,通过支撑卡块16用于将电路板3与支撑骨架8间隔开,即台阶形支撑卡块16用于限定电路板3与支撑骨架8之间的间距,卡接扣板17用于将电路板3与支撑骨架8扣紧固定;电路板3与支撑骨架8之间的间距为H,电路板3与支撑骨架8之间间距不大于2mm,本实施例中,H=1.57mm;通过间距H的设置,有效保证电路板3与电芯2之间具有一定的散热效果。
如图2和4所示,针孔式端子10和/或第二接口12沿着电芯2的正负极轴线方向向外延伸;第二接口12沿着电芯2的正负极轴线方向向外伸出设置,即针孔式端子10和第二接口12的插接方向都是沿电池包的最长边的方向设置,更加便于使用。
本实施例中,壳体1对应第三电连接器6和第四电连接器7配置有对应的连接器开孔27,具体来说,连接器开孔27包括第一开孔18和第二开孔19,第二接口12与第二开孔19相对应;针孔式端子10与第一开孔18相对应;并且第二接口12与针孔式端子10并列设置在电池包同一端部,即通过针孔式端子10和第二接口12的设置,同时实现了本实施例中电池包的多功能适用的问题,并且整体结构小巧,使用起来简单方便。
并且第三电连接器6与支撑骨架8之间设有安装间隙,以及第四电连接器7与支撑骨架8之间设有安装间隙,具体的,第四电连接器7略微突出于第三电连接器6,第三电连接器6、第四电连接器7与支撑骨架8之间的安装间隙通过防水密封垫9进行密封,防水密封垫9上设有与第三电连接器6、第四电连接器7相对应的开槽,防水密封垫9套设在第四电连接器7上,即第四电连接器7略微突出于第三电连接器6的部位,并且防水密封垫9通过支撑骨架8与壳体1之间 的轻微挤压变形,将安装间隙完全密封住,同时与第三电连接器6和第四电连接器7侧壁完全贴紧,进一步保证密封效果,同时通过第四电连接器7起到相应的定位安装的效果。
本实施例中的电池包通过电芯2作为电源供电,并且采用单节21700电芯,适用于的电动工具并不仅局限于无绳类手持电动工具,还包括园林工具,无绳吸尘器,直流空压机等采用二次电池作为动力源的动力作业设备;大大提高了电池包的适用范围,并且整体结构简单,还能够作为便携式的移动电源使用,体积小巧,功能性更强。
并且第一电连接器4和第二电连接器5至少包括沿着电芯2的正负极轴线方向延伸的纵向折弯段,即直角形折弯第一电连接器4和第二电连接器5分别用于连接电芯的正负极和电路板3。
实施例2:
相较于实施例1,在本实施例中,电池包上设置的第三电连接器6的接口设有2个,包括一个针孔式端子10和一个USB接口,如图4所示,针孔式端子10和USB接口分别设置在电池包两端;针孔式端子10的设置同实施例1中的设置,USB接口设置在与针孔式端子10在电池包上相对的一侧。
通过USB接口的设置进一步提高本实施例电池包作为移动电源使用时的适用范围。
实施例3:
相较于实施例1,在本实施例中,壳体1包括用于容纳电芯2的第一壳体20、及至少一个第二壳体21,第二壳体21设置在电芯2的正极和/或负极端,并且第一壳体20与第二壳体21组成一用于容纳电芯2的密闭腔体;具体来说,如图3所示,本实施例中,第一壳体20和第二壳体21分别有且仅有一个,第二壳体21设置在电芯2的 正极或负极端,第一壳体20和第二壳体21之间具有一弯曲并闭合的分离边缘,分离边缘位于同一平面内;并且分离边缘所在平面与电芯2的正极和负极所在平面平行,即第二壳体21的边沿即为与第一壳体20配合的分离边缘,第二壳体21所在平面垂直于电芯2的正负极轴线方向,并且第一壳体20为桶形;壳体1容纳电芯2的径向周侧的外表面上没有分离的边缘,第一壳体20为一体式结构,第二壳体21内嵌式固定在第一壳体20的端部,具体来说,第一壳体20与第二壳体21通过卡接式结构相互嵌合卡接固定,第一壳体20与第二壳体21的分离边缘位于壳体1的外端面处;本实施例的壳体1结构侧壁没有可见的分离边缘,体现出一体式的设计感,作为移动电源使用时握持手感更好。
并且第一壳体20与第二壳体21之间密封连接,密封连接的方式为超声焊接,进一步提高整体的密封性。
实施例4:
相较于实施例1,在本实施例中,支撑骨架8端部延伸设有固定架14,其适于将第三电连接器6和第四电连接器7以夹设限位;如图6所示,第三电连接器6和第四电连接器7设置在电池包的同一侧,并且上下叠放设置,固定架14为支撑骨架8端部向下延伸出的两个固定脚,两个固定脚之间的空间用于对第三电连接器6和第四电连接器7以夹设限位,起到相应的定位安装的作用,同时固定架14会与防水密封垫9侧边压紧抵接,进一步提高防水密封垫9对电池包的密封效果。
